Karr, Alan F. - In: Journal of Multivariate Analysis 16 (1985) 3, pp. 368-392
Given i.i.d. point processes N1, N2,..., let the observations be p-thinnings N'1, N'2,..., where p is a function from the underlying space E (a compact metric space) to [0, 1], whose interpretation is that a point of Ni at x is retained with probability p(x) and deleted with probability 1-p(x)....
